'Hi

How do I un-hide a buffer?

I have been using 'set bufhidden=hidden' to hide the current buffer
('set hidden' sets all buffers to hidden).
I don't know how to set it back to normal.

I have checked the help, google and tip #135 (very handy) but have not
found the answer.

To add one more question. How would I save the current edit session so I could reload it with all the same buffers (and also tabs and splits if possible) at a later stage?

In answer to your first question, you simply use the ":unhide" or ":sunhide" commands.
To save a Vim session, use the ":mksession <path>" command. For further instruction, I would
refer to the documentation.
